对象存储方式,揭秘对象存储,从数据存储到数据管理的完整过程
- 综合资讯
- 2024-12-18 05:47:40
- 2

对象存储方式,是一种高效的数据存储方式。本文揭秘了从数据存储到数据管理的完整过程,包括对象存储的概念、原理、优势、应用场景以及未来发展趋势。...
对象存储方式,是一种高效的数据存储方式。本文揭秘了从数据存储到数据管理的完整过程,包括对象存储的概念、原理、优势、应用场景以及未来发展趋势。
随着互联网的快速发展,数据已成为企业的重要资产,对象存储作为一种新型数据存储方式,因其高效、灵活、可扩展等优势,逐渐成为企业数据存储的首选,本文将详细介绍对象存储的存储过程,帮助读者全面了解这一先进的数据存储技术。
对象存储概述
对象存储是一种基于对象的数据存储技术,它将数据以对象的形式存储在分布式存储系统中,对象存储系统主要由以下几部分组成:
1、对象:存储的基本单元,由数据、元数据、唯一标识符(ID)和版本号组成。
2、存储节点:负责存储对象的物理设备,如硬盘、SSD等。
3、存储集群:由多个存储节点组成的集合,实现数据的分布式存储。
4、控制节点:负责管理存储集群,包括对象数据的分配、存储、检索、删除等操作。
5、网络层:负责数据在存储节点之间的传输。
对象存储的存储过程
1、数据上传
用户将需要存储的数据上传到对象存储系统,数据上传过程如下:
(1)用户通过HTTP、HTTPS、FTP等协议将数据上传到对象存储系统。
(2)对象存储系统接收数据,并根据数据大小进行分片。
(3)分片后的数据传输到存储节点进行存储。
2、数据存储
(1)对象存储系统将分片后的数据存储到存储节点。
(2)存储节点根据存储策略将数据分配到不同的物理设备。
(3)存储节点将数据写入硬盘或SSD等物理设备。
3、数据索引
(1)对象存储系统为每个存储的对象生成唯一标识符(ID)。
(2)根据对象ID、元数据等信息,建立索引,方便数据检索。
4、数据冗余
为了提高数据可靠性,对象存储系统采用数据冗余技术,数据冗余方式如下:
(1)副本:在存储节点之间复制相同的数据,提高数据可靠性。
(2)校验:为数据添加校验码,以便在数据损坏时进行恢复。
5、数据访问
用户通过HTTP、HTTPS、FTP等协议访问对象存储系统中的数据,数据访问过程如下:
(1)用户向对象存储系统发送访问请求。
(2)对象存储系统根据请求中的对象ID查找索引。
(3)找到数据后,对象存储系统将数据返回给用户。
6、数据删除
用户可以向对象存储系统发送删除请求,删除不需要的数据,数据删除过程如下:
(1)对象存储系统根据请求中的对象ID查找索引。
(2)找到数据后,对象存储系统将数据从存储节点中删除。
(3)删除数据后,对象存储系统更新索引,释放资源。
对象存储的优势
1、高效:对象存储采用分布式存储架构,提高了数据读写速度。
2、灵活:对象存储支持多种数据格式,方便用户存储和管理各类数据。
3、可扩展:对象存储系统可根据需求动态扩展存储空间。
4、安全:对象存储系统提供数据加密、访问控制等安全措施,保障数据安全。
5、节约成本:对象存储系统采用通用硬件设备,降低了存储成本。
对象存储作为一种高效、灵活、可扩展的数据存储方式,在数据存储领域具有广泛的应用前景,本文详细介绍了对象存储的存储过程,希望对读者了解和掌握这一技术有所帮助,随着互联网技术的不断发展,对象存储将在未来发挥更加重要的作用。
本文链接:https://www.zhitaoyun.cn/1636099.html
发表评论